Obtaining a gazette notification for a name change in India typically involves a multi-step process. First, you'll need to create a name change affidavit, which must be notarized. Next, you'll publish a public notice of your name change in local newspapers. Finally, you'll submit an application along with the required documents, including the affidavit and newspaper clippings, to the Department of Publication. Once processed, your name change will be published in the Gazette of India, providing official legal recognition of your new name.
